Frequently Asked Questions about Brickell
What type of rentals are currently available in Brickell?
There are currently 405 Apartments for Rent in Brickell, FL with pricing that ranges from $1,300 to $22,500. There are also 696 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Brickell ranging from $1,300 to $55,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Brickell?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Brickell ranges from $1,300 to $55,000 with an average monthly rent of $11,847.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Brickell?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Brickell range from $4,650 to $19,500,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$3,900 to $20,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$4,100 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$10,000.
